the Outcomes of Laparoscopic Cholecystectomy for Acute Cholecystitis Within and Beyond the First 72 Hours, Does it Differ?!

About this trial

Compare outcomes of patients undergoing early laparoscopic cholecystectomy within and after72 hours of symptoms.

Eligibility criteria

Qualifiers

Patients with acute cholecystitis within and after 72 hours.

Patients over 18 years.

Patients with no common bile duct stones based on imaging and biochemical criteria

Fit for surgery.

Disqualifiers

Patients not fit for surgery

Patients with Pancreatitis.

Significant medical disease rendering patient unfit for Laparoscopic surgery (e.g. Uncontrolled Diabetes Mellitus, Chronic Pulmonary Disease, significant Cardiac Disease)
